ALGIM Conference - Early Bird Tickets on Sale now

ALGIM are gearing up for the 2025 ALGIM Annual Conference, scheduled for November 25-27 at the Tākina Conference Centre in Wellington

ALGIM are thrilled to share some exciting updates. This year promises to be bigger than before…

Their 2025 theme focuses on “Collaborating Beyond Council Boundaries,” enabling them to foster discussions and partnerships delivering greater value to our communities by working together.

This year, the conference will have an educational focus and a new stream – Data and Insights which will encompass spatial data.

They are really excited to announce that our opening keynote speaker is “The Original Internet Godfather” Brett Johnson. Originally a centre figure in the cybercrime world for over 20 years, today Brett works as a security consultant and speaker all over the world.

Early bird registration is now available for the ALGIM Conference 2025, held in Wellington from 25–27 November. Options include full conference, one-day, and student passes. Group discounts are offered for three or more delegates from the same organisation. Full registrations include sessions, catering, networking events, and a ticket to the Gala Dinner. 

The event takes place at Tākina Wellington Convention and Exhibition Centre, located at 50 Cable Street. Easily accessible by foot, bus, train, or taxi, the venue is near public parking and local amenities. Cyclists can use public bike racks on Wakefield Street.
